个人博客
原型模式 原型模式
原型模式原型模式(Prototype Pattern)是用于创建重复的对象,同时又能保证性能。这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。 这种模式是实现了一个原型接口,该接口用于创建当前对象的克隆。当直接创建对象的代
2022-07-12
工厂模式-抽象工厂模式 工厂模式-抽象工厂模式
工厂模式-抽象工厂模式 抽象工厂模式:定义了一个interface用于创建相关或有依赖关系的对象簇,而无需指明具体的类 抽象工厂模式可以将简单工厂模式和工厂方法模式进行整合 从设计层面看,抽象工厂模式就是对简单工厂模式的改进(或者称为进
2022-07-12
工厂模式-工厂方法模式 工厂模式-工厂方法模式
工厂模式-工厂方法模式看一个新的需求 披萨项目新的需求:客户在点披萨时,可以点不同b风味的披萨,比如北京的奶酪pizza,北京的胡椒pizza,伦敦的胡椒pizza,或者伦敦的奶酪披萨 思路一: 使用简单工厂模式,创建不同的工厂类,比如BJ
2022-07-12
工厂模式-简单工厂模式 工厂模式-简单工厂模式
工厂模式-简单工厂模式工厂模式(Factory Pattern)是最常用的一类创建型设计模式,包含简单工厂模式(Simple Factory Pattern)、工厂方法模式(Factory Method Pattern)和抽象工厂模式(Ab
2022-07-12
单例模式 单例模式
单例模式所 谓 类 的 单 例 设 计 模 式 , 就 是 采 取 一 定 的 方 注 保 证 在 整 个 的 软 件 系 统 中 , 对 某 个 类 只 能 存 在 一 个 对 象 实 例 , 并 且 该 类 只 提 供 一 个 取 得
2022-07-10
类的依赖、泛化、实现、关联、聚合和组合 类的依赖、泛化、实现、关联、聚合和组合
类的依赖、泛化、实现、关联、聚合和组合1.依赖关系(Dependence)只要在类中用到了对方,那么他们之间就存在依赖关系。如果没有对方连编译都过不了。 public class PersonServiceBean { privat
2022-07-08
电子账务系统 电子账务系统
项目地址: 前端:https://gitee.com/CZJCoder/electronic_account_web 后端:https://gitee.com/CZJCoder/electronic_account_mid electron
2022-07-03
Mybatis 缓存机制 Mybatis 缓存机制
Mybatis 缓存机制Mybatis一级缓存一级缓存是SqlSession级别的,通过同一个SqlSession查询的数据会被缓存,下次查询相同的数据,就会从缓存中直接获取,不会从数据库重新访问,一级缓存是默认开启的 使一级缓存失效的四种
2022-04-29
Docker Docker
Docker昨天实习面试被问到了docker,但是我上一次写dockerfile和使用docker-compose编排服务的时候还是在去年,忘得一干二净/(ㄒoㄒ)/~~ 结果一问三不知,所以在这里做个笔记当作复习吧。 什么是Docker
2022-04-28
Java 内部类 Java 内部类
内部类分类 成员内部类:分为静态内部类和非静态内部类 局部内部类 匿名内部类 成员内部类作为其外部类成员的内部类,称为成员内部类。除另有说明外,“内部类”通常是指成员内部类。 与实例的方法和变量一样,内部类与其外围类的实例相关联,并
2022-04-25
12 / 15